MorGen Energy ApS is a Danish subsidiary of MorGen Energy AG, a wholly-owned hydrogen business of Trafigura focused on developing large-scale green hydrogen ecosystems across Europe. Formerly known as H2 Energy Europe, the company rebranded in 2024 following Trafigura's majority acquisition.
The company supplies, distributes, and stores green hydrogen produced via electrolysis using renewable energy, targeting hard-to-abate sectors such as industry, maritime, and heavy transport to support decarbonization.
Key projects include the Njordkraft facility in Esbjerg, Denmark—a scalable up to 1 GW electrolyser plant aiming to produce 135,000 tonnes of green hydrogen annually, avoiding 1.1 million tonnes of CO2 emissions per year, with distribution via pipelines to Germany and beyond; it recently secured €422.75 million from the European Hydrogen Bank for its 300 MW phase. Other developments encompass a 20 MW plant in Milford Haven, Wales (FID reached in 2026), a 60 MW facility in Teesside, UK, and hydrogen refuelling infrastructure.
